Noah Lyles confirmed talks of race with Tyreek Hill

Noah Lyles, the American sprinter and reigning world champion, recently confirmed his discussions with NFL star Tyreek Hill regarding the intersection of their sports and the significance of speed in both track and football.

Lyles, known for his incredible sprinting abilities, expressed admiration for Hill’s prowess as a wide receiver, highlighting how both athletes prioritize speed as a fundamental aspect of their performance.

The conversations began as a friendly exchange, with Lyles wanting to learn from Hill about the techniques and training regimens that contribute to elite performance in football.

Hill, known for his explosive speed and agility, shared insights into how he prepares for games, including drills focused on acceleration and endurance. Lyles found this particularly interesting, given the differences in their sports’ demands and the unique skills required for each.

Lyles also touched upon the broader narrative of athleticism and representation in both sports. He emphasized the importance of recognizing the talent in track and field, often overshadowed by mainstream sports like football. The two athletes discussed how they could leverage their platforms to inspire young athletes, regardless of the sport, to pursue their passions.

Their discussions reflect a growing trend among athletes to engage across sports, sharing knowledge and experiences.

Both Lyles and Hill are recognized not just for their individual achievements but also for their roles as ambassadors of their sports, advocating for greater appreciation and understanding of athletic excellence. This collaboration serves as a reminder that speed is a universal currency in athletics, transcending the boundaries of track and field and football alike.
